Roles & Responsibilities
- Oversee all nursing services to ensure safe, effective, and compassionate long-term resident care
- Lead assessment, care planning, implementation, and evaluation to improve resident outcomes
- Supervise, mentor, and schedule RNs, LPNs, CNAs, and nurse managers to build a high-performing team
- Drive regulatory compliance and prepare the facility for surveys, inspections, and audits
- Develop and lead QAPI initiatives to continuously improve quality and safety
- Manage nursing department operations including staffing levels, documentation accuracy, and resource use
- Provide hands-on clinical leadership—teaching, coaching, and stepping in when resident care needs you
- Participate in facility leadership planning to align nursing goals with organizational strategy

Travel Perks: Explore St Ignace, MI
St. Ignace is your gateway to Upper Peninsula adventures. Enjoy easy access to the Mackinac Bridge and ferries to scenic Mackinac Island with its historic downtown, bike trails, and car-free charm. Spend weekends exploring Lake Huron shorelines, local fishing and boating, nature trails and birdwatching, or take day trips to nearby Sault Ste. Marie and the Soo Locks. The region is perfect for outdoor enthusiasts—hiking, kayaking, snowmobiling and cross-country skiing are all within reach, plus cozy local dining and community events to help you feel at home.
